
Charlie Schlatter
Birthday: 1966-05-01 | Place of Birth: Englewood, New Jersey, USAFrom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Charles Thomas "Charlie" Schlatter (born May 1, 1966 in Englewood, New Jersey) is an American actor. He has starred in numerous TV series and films, and is well-known for his role in the series Diagnosis: Murder as Dr. Jesse Travis with Dick Van Dyke, and for his role in the film 18 Again! with George Burns. Since 2004, he has been primarily a voice actor.
